当前位置:首页 > 虚拟化 > 正文

全虚拟化技术有哪些(桌面虚拟化技术有哪些)

全虚拟化技术
全虚拟化技术是一种虚拟化技术,它允许在物理服务器上创建多个虚拟机(VM),每个虚拟机都可以独立运行自己的操作系统和应用程序。
要素
硬件虚拟化支持:全虚拟化技术需要物理服务器支持硬件虚拟化,通常通过英特尔的VT-x或AMD的AMD-V来实现。
虚拟机管理程序:虚拟机管理程序(hypervisor)是一个软件层,它管理底层物理资源并将它们分配给虚拟机。
虚拟化客户机操作系统:每个虚拟机都运行自己的客户机操作系统,就像它在物理计算机上运行一样。
虚拟机抽象层:虚拟机管理程序使用抽象层将物理资源呈现给虚拟机,使其看起来像是物理机。
资源分配:虚拟机管理程序负责分配物理资源(例如 CPU、内存和存储)给虚拟机。
设备模拟:虚拟机管理程序提供模拟的硬件设备,例如网络适配器和存储控制器,以支持虚拟机的操作。
快照和回滚:全虚拟化技术通常支持创建虚拟机的快照,允许在出现问题时将虚拟机回滚到先前的状态。
示例
VMware vSphere
Microsoft Hyper-V
Citrix XenServer
KVM (Kernel-based Virtual Machine)
Oracle VirtualBox